National Public Lands Day 2016

Volunteers of all ages are invited to join Tumacácori to celebrate the 23rd Annual National Public Lands Day. Together we will celebrate our shared public lands by cleaning up trash along the 1.5 mile section of the Anza Trail within the national park (3 mile round trip). https://www.nps.gov/tuma/learn/news/national-public-lands-day-2016.htm Source:: National Public Lands Day 2016
